Battle of Plassey (1757) resulted in the establishment of English control over the Nawabs of Bengal
The first cantonment was built in Barrackpore (1765).
•The Kanpur Cantonment was established in the year 1811
•The Bangalore Cantonment was established b/w the years 1806–1881
•The Delhi Cantonment was established (1904)
